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1334329831 2905610 11605177 64790
088911118 3012 537879
088911118 3012 537879
76 705 687
All about undefined
Interested in learning more?
088911118 3012 537879
76 705 687
See more
95300 675795793
09591201 90298144555 0708
See more
895 981568124
15 286 93949099 331
See more